Scotlyn "Scotty" Longpre is cheeky and stubborn and gets into other people's business every chance she gets. On the flip side, she is hard-working and friendly. Most of all, she is entertaining. The people of St. Thomas love her. After three years of living on St. Thomas, Scotty knows it was worth abandoning her former life and starting a new one far away from her past. True to her style, she butts into a deckhand's business. She jumps at the chance to make things right for him, even though she doesn't know his name. That's understandable because he was dead when she met him. That means nothing to Scotty. She wants to discover who he is, what happened, and why a deck chair is chained to him. Her mind is made up. Then, a wealthy tourist hires her and her friend, out-of-work cop Miles Dunn, who needs a job, to find his kidnapped teenage daughter, and the case becomes her obsession. She disregards everything, including Ash Parrish, the man who loves her, and Harold "Cutie" Pickering, her business partner. All Scotty wants is her quiet, routine, island life back, and the faster that happens, the better. Nobody messes with Scotty and what she wants. After an international gun dealer, a human trafficker, and a hitman arrive on St. Thomas, Scotty gets in their way. The three men want her dead. She is the only thing between them and their plans to make millions of dollars. They find out there's no changing Scotty's mind. Not a stalker, a hitman, a hurricane, nor breaking the law will stop her. It's all or nothing. For Scotty, it's "Worth It!" .
